Interface UnmarshallAction

All Superinterfaces:
Action, ActivityContent, ActivityNode, Element, org.eclipse.emf.ecore.EModelElement, org.eclipse.emf.ecore.EObject, ExecutableNode, NamedElement, org.eclipse.emf.common.notify.Notifier, RedefinableElement

public interface UnmarshallAction
extends Action

A representation of the model object 'Unmarshall Action'. An UnmarshallAction is an Action that retrieves the values of the StructuralFeatures of an object and places them on OutputPins.

From package UML::Actions.

validateMultiplicityOfObject

boolean validateMultiplicityOfObject(org.eclipse.emf.common.util.DiagnosticChain diagnostics,
                                     java.util.Map<java.lang.Object,java.lang.Object> context)
The multiplicity of the object InputPin is 1..1 object.is(1,1)

Parameters:
diagnostics - The chain of diagnostics to which problems are to be appended.
context - The cache of context-specific information.

validateObjectType

boolean validateObjectType(org.eclipse.emf.common.util.DiagnosticChain diagnostics,
                           java.util.Map<java.lang.Object,java.lang.Object> context)
The type of the object InputPin conform to the unmarshallType. object.type.conformsTo(unmarshallType)

Parameters:
diagnostics - The chain of diagnostics to which problems are to be appended.
context - The cache of context-specific information.

validateNumberOfResult

boolean validateNumberOfResult(org.eclipse.emf.common.util.DiagnosticChain diagnostics,
                               java.util.Map<java.lang.Object,java.lang.Object> context)
The number of result outputPins must be the same as the number of attributes of the unmarshallType. unmarshallType.allAttributes()->size() = result->size()

Parameters:
diagnostics - The chain of diagnostics to which problems are to be appended.
context - The cache of context-specific information.

validateTypeOrderingAndMultiplicity

boolean validateTypeOrderingAndMultiplicity(org.eclipse.emf.common.util.DiagnosticChain diagnostics,
                                            java.util.Map<java.lang.Object,java.lang.Object> context)
The type, ordering and multiplicity of each attribute of the unmarshallType must be compatible with the type, ordering and multiplicity of the corresponding result OutputPin. let attribute:OrderedSet(Property) = unmarshallType.allAttributes() in Sequence{1..result->size()}->forAll(i | attribute->at(i).type.conformsTo(result->at(i).type) and attribute->at(i).isOrdered=result->at(i).isOrdered and attribute->at(i).compatibleWith(result->at(i)))

Parameters:
diagnostics - The chain of diagnostics to which problems are to be appended.
context - The cache of context-specific information.

validateStructuralFeature

boolean validateStructuralFeature(org.eclipse.emf.common.util.DiagnosticChain diagnostics,
                                  java.util.Map<java.lang.Object,java.lang.Object> context)
The unmarshallType must have at least one StructuralFeature. unmarshallType.allAttributes()->size() >= 1

Parameters:
diagnostics - The chain of diagnostics to which problems are to be appended.
context - The cache of context-specific information.
